  • Patent number: 7081352
    Abstract: A chemiluminescent system for detecting the presence of influenza virus in a biological fluid sample is provided. An influenza diagnostic kit is provided which includes (1) a sampling device for obtaining the biological fluid from a subject, (2) a chemiluminescent substrate material which, in the presence of influenza virus in the biological sample, will generate a chemiluminescent product that will produce detectable light, and (3) a means for detecting any generated light. A liquid sample containing the biological fluid, and preferably a diluent, are contacted with the an absorbent material containing the chemiluminescent substrate material. The substrate responds to neuraminidase activity intrinsic to influenza A and influenza B virus particles, such that when the substrate is in contact with influenza virus, the substrate is cleaved to yield a chemiluminescent product that then decomposes to produce light which can then be detected.

  • Patent number: 5766841
    Abstract: A kit for visually detecting the presence of a virus in a direct clinical specimen is provided. The kit employs a rapid and direct assay for visually detecting a virus having a characteristic enzyme in a direct clinical sample without the need for any culturing step, This assay contains the following steps: (1) the clinical sample is contacted in solution with a substrate for the enzyme which includes a chromogen that is cleaved from the substrate by the enzyme and a precipitating agent which reacts with the liberated chromogen to form a precipitate, (2) the precipitate is concentrated, and (3) the concentrated precipitate is visually observed for the characteristic color of the chromogen. The observance of the characteristic color confirms the presence of the virus in the clinical specimen.
